## Ownership

Hot-reload of config in Fernvault lives in `reloader/`. Watcher debounce, schema validation, and rollback-on-bad-parse are all in scope. Do not merge changes to reload semantics without sign-off — a bad reload once took down the Marrowtide cluster. Tests in `reloader/spec` must pass untouched. Review requests for this path go to the owner listed below.

account owner for bawip-tahag: Raleth Quenok

The current points model will be replaced with a three-tier structure (Bronze, Silver, Merrowgold), simplifying accrual and reducing redemption liability by an estimated 8%. Existing balances convert at a fixed ratio; customers will be notified in phases. Sales leads should prepare talking points for top accounts and avoid committing to tier placements until conversion runs complete. Training materials follow next week. Before briefing your teams, review the following.

board note of kagep-yahig: Only 9 of the 120 pilot accounts renewed Quenix, so a churn review is set for April 1.

Handover note: the Gravelight audit-log viewer is stable but quirky. Filtering by actor is fast; filtering by resource path hits the slow index and can take twenty seconds on large tenants — known issue, tracked but not urgent. Retention is ninety days and the export job runs nightly. I rotated the service account last month, so nothing is due until spring. Future maintainers should mostly leave this alone. For completeness, the production configuration the viewer currently runs with is recorded below.

config for tawif-bagef:
[sorwyn]
team = sorys
access_code = ac_9ba40c
host = sorwyn.ordingrid.local
port = 5000
owner = aldok.quenion
peer = belath.paliqcloud.local

Facilities ticket — Halewick Tower, night shift.

Issue: support team reporting east stairwell reader rejecting badges after midnight. Reader was reset this morning; firmware updated. Overnight crew should now badge as normal. If the reader fails again, use the manual keypad by the fire door — do not prop the door. Log any further failures with the time and badge name. Temporary keypad code for the fallback door is below.

door code, tajeg-fawip: bdg-K-62